What do you do when you can’t get your hands on a set of Marvel’s Spider-Man 2 PS5 faceplates? You make your own! Okay, that’s not an option that’s open to most of us. But one accessory manufacturer is making a set of Spider-Man 2 style faceplates and they are absolutely trolling the hell out of Sony over them.
If you missed the news, Sony unveiled a special Marvel’s Spider-Man 2 PlayStation 5, with custom controllers and Venomized faceplates. They also made the faceplates and controllers available separately, and they went on sale at the end of July. They sold out almost immediately and are being sold on eBay for around a 50% markup.
Dbrand has seen an opportunity, thumbing their nose at Sony with their ‘Arachnoplates’, remarking, “The [POPULAR VIDEO GAME CONSOLE] maker [MEGACORP] failed to produce enough stock of their [LICENSED VIDEO GAME] side panels Thanks for dropping the ball, you [SERIES OF EXPLETIVES].”
Give how much legal muscle Sony and Marvel have between them, that seems like a risky idea. As reported by Gamesindustry.biz, Sony threatened Dbrand with legal action when they first launched their line of third party faceplates. They modified the design to less resemble Sony’s own design but we wouldn’t be surprised if Sony has kept one eye on the company.

On the other hand, it’s marketing genius. No-one’s fooled into thinking that Dbrand is somehow edgy for doing this but we’ve absolutely got our popcorn ready to see if Sony does bring the hammer. And we’re talking about it, which is exactly what Dbrand wants.
As for the faceplates? They’re pretty cool, though this is likely just a pre-release render. Dbrand has, wisely, not attempted to include any kind of logo. But we absolutely think ‘Spider-Man’ when we look at these. You can pre-order them from Dbrand’s own site, with a shipping date of October 20th.
